Save Costs on Amazon EKS with CAST AI for Kubernetes

Save Costs on Amazon EKS with CAST AI for Kubernetes

Table of Contents

  1. Introduction
  2. What is Cast AI?
  3. Integrating Amazon EKS Cluster with Cast AI
  4. Leveraging AI Capabilities for Cost Optimization
  5. Analyzing Cluster Resources and Cost Monitoring
  6. Available Savings and Optimizations
  7. Restructuring Nodes for Cost Savings
  8. Enabling Auto Scaling and Rebalancing
  9. Security Features and Insights
  10. Conclusion

Introduction

In this article, we will explore the cloud optimization platform, Cast AI, and how it can be integrated with an Amazon Elastic Kubernetes Service (EKS) cluster for cost optimizations. Cast AI is a software-as-a-service (SaaS) product that utilizes artificial intelligence to analyze and optimize the cost of Kubernetes clusters. By leveraging Cast AI's capabilities, users can restructure their EKS cluster to reduce costs and achieve optimal resource allocation.

What is Cast AI?

Cast AI is a cloud optimization platform designed for cost optimizations in Kubernetes clusters, like Amazon EKS. It provides AI-driven analysis and optimization recommendations to help organizations optimize their cloud expenses. By integrating with Cast AI, users can benefit from its back-end artificial intelligence, which analyzes cluster resources and offers suggestions for cost optimization.

Integrating Amazon EKS Cluster with Cast AI

To start optimizing the cost of an Amazon EKS cluster using Cast AI, the cluster needs to be integrated with the Cast AI platform. This integration involves installing the Cast AI agent on the EKS cluster and establishing a connection between the agent and the Cast AI platform. Once connected, Cast AI can Gather data from the cluster and provide cost optimization recommendations Based on its analysis.

Leveraging AI Capabilities for Cost Optimization

Once the Amazon EKS cluster is successfully integrated with Cast AI, users can leverage its AI capabilities for cost optimization. Cast AI uses artificial intelligence to analyze the cluster's resources and provides recommendations on how to optimize costs. By following these recommendations, users can achieve efficient resource allocation and reduce unnecessary expenses.

Analyzing Cluster Resources and Cost Monitoring

Cast AI offers a comprehensive dashboard that provides insights into the resources and cost of the Amazon EKS cluster. Users can monitor and analyze various aspects of the cluster, such as CPU utilization, memory consumption, and overall cost. The dashboard also provides visualizations and reports to help users understand their cluster's cost allocation.

Available Savings and Optimizations

With Cast AI, users can explore available savings and optimization opportunities for their Amazon EKS cluster. The platform provides estimates of potential cost savings based on different optimization strategies. Users can analyze these recommendations and choose the optimization options that best suit their cluster's requirements.

Restructuring Nodes for Cost Savings

One of the key features of Cast AI is its ability to restructure nodes in order to achieve cost savings. By analyzing the cluster's workload and resource usage, Cast AI can recommend changes to nodes' configurations. Users can reassign workloads and resize nodes to optimize costs without compromising performance.

Enabling Auto Scaling and Rebalancing

Cast AI offers an auto-scaling feature that helps optimize cluster resources by automatically adjusting the number of nodes based on usage and workload demands. With auto-scaling enabled, Cast AI can dynamically Scale nodes up or down to accommodate varying resource requirements. Additionally, the platform provides a rebalancing capability that redistributes workloads across nodes to achieve optimal resource allocation and cost savings.

Security Features and Insights

In addition to cost optimization, Cast AI also provides security insights for Amazon EKS clusters. The platform analyzes the cluster's security configurations and offers recommendations to enhance security. Users can access security reports and take necessary actions to ensure their cluster's security posture.

Conclusion

Cast AI is a powerful cloud optimization platform that can help organizations optimize the cost of their Amazon EKS clusters. By integrating with Cast AI and leveraging its AI-driven recommendations, users can achieve efficient resource allocation and reduce unnecessary expenses. With features like auto-scaling, rebalancing, and security insights, Cast AI provides a comprehensive solution for cost optimization and cluster management.

Now let's dive deeper into each topic in the following article.


[Insert catchy subheading here]

[Write detailed article content here, following the structure provided in the Table of Contents. Communicate the information in a conversational tone, using personal pronouns and engaging the reader. Incorporate analogies and metaphors to enhance understanding.]


Conclusion

In conclusion, Cast AI is a valuable tool for optimizing the cost of Amazon EKS clusters. By integrating with Cast AI and leveraging its AI-driven insights and recommendations, organizations can achieve significant cost savings and efficient resource allocation. The platform's features, such as auto-scaling, rebalancing, and security insights, provide comprehensive support for cluster optimization and management. With Cast AI, users can unlock the full potential of their Amazon EKS clusters while minimizing expenses and maximizing performance.

Highlights

  • Cast AI is a cloud optimization platform for cost optimizations in Kubernetes clusters.
  • Integrating Amazon EKS clusters with Cast AI enables efficient cost optimization.
  • Leveraging AI capabilities allows for intelligent analysis and recommendations for cost optimization.
  • Cast AI's dashboard provides insights into cluster resources and cost allocations.
  • Auto-scaling and rebalancing features optimize resource allocation and minimize costs.
  • Security insights ensure the cluster's security posture and offer recommendations for improvements.

FAQ

Q: How does Cast AI help optimize Amazon EKS cluster costs?

A: Cast AI uses artificial intelligence to analyze cluster resources, identify optimization opportunities, and provide recommendations for cost savings. The platform's features, such as auto-scaling and rebalancing, enable efficient resource allocation and minimize unnecessary expenses.

Q: Can Cast AI help optimize other Kubernetes clusters apart from Amazon EKS?

A: Yes, Cast AI supports various Kubernetes clusters, including AKS, GKE, and OpenShift. Organizations using different Kubernetes distributions can leverage Cast AI for cost optimization and cluster management.

Q: Is it safe to enable Cast AI to modify the EKS cluster?

A: Enabling Cast AI to modify the EKS cluster allows for advanced Kubernetes automation, cost optimization, and security insights. However, it is crucial to thoroughly assess the changes before implementing them and ensure they Align with the organization's requirements and best practices.

Q: How does Cast AI handle security considerations for EKS clusters?

A: Cast AI provides security insights and recommendations for EKS clusters to enhance their overall security posture. By analyzing security configurations and providing actionable suggestions, Cast AI helps organizations ensure their clusters are well-protected against potential threats.

Q: Can Cast AI be used for other cloud providers' Kubernetes services?

A: Currently, Cast AI primarily focuses on optimizing Kubernetes clusters on Amazon EKS. However, the platform's roadmap may include support for other cloud providers' Kubernetes services in the future.

Most people like

Find AI tools in Toolify

Join TOOLIFY to find the ai tools

Get started

Sign Up
App rating
4.9
AI Tools
20k+
Trusted Users
5000+
No complicated
No difficulty
Free forever
Browse More Content